C# 基本信息介绍
总目录
前言
对 C# 做一个基本信息介绍,让我们对 C# 有个基本的认识。
在进行本文的阅读之前,可以瞧瞧 编程基础知识简述 简单的入个门儿。
一、C#
1. C# 概述
C#是由微软公司发布的一种由C和C++衍生出来的面向对象的编程语言。
2. C# 介绍
- C#(读作“C Sharp”)
- C# 是面向对象的、面向组件的 高级编程语言。
- C#是由C和C++衍生出来的一种安全的、稳定的、简单的、优雅的面向对象编程语言。它在继承C和C++强大功能的同时去掉了一些它们的复杂特性(例如,没有宏以及不允许多重继承)。
- C#综合了VB简单的可视化操作和C++的高运行效率,以其强大的操作能力、优雅的语法风格、创新的语言特性和便捷的面向组件编程的支持成为 .NET开发 的首选语言。
- C# 语言是适用于 .NET 平台(免费的跨平台开源开发环境)的最流行语言。 C# 程序可以在许多不同的设备上运行,从物联网 (IoT) 设备到云以及介于两者之间的任何设备。 可为手机、台式机、笔记本电脑和服务器编写应用。
- C# 是一种跨平台的通用语言,可以让开发人员在编写高性能代码时提高工作效率。 C# 是数百万开发人员中最受欢迎的 .NET 语言。 C# 在生态系统和所有 .NET 工作负载中具有广泛的支持。 基于面向对象的原则,它融合了其他范例中的许多功能,尤其是函数编程。 低级功能支持高效方案,无需编写不安全的代码。 大多数 .NET 运行时和库都是用 C# 编写的,C# 的进步通常会使所有 .NET 开发人员受益。
二、开发环境准备
1. 什么叫做IDE
- 集成开发环境(简称:IDE;英文名:Integrated Development Environment )
- 是用于提供程序开发环境的应用程序,一般包括代码编辑器、编译器、调试器和图形用户界面等工具。集成了代码编写功能、分析功能、编译功能、调试功能等一体化的开发软件服务套。具备这一特性的软件或者软件套(组)都可以叫集成开发环境。
简单点理解:IDE 就是程序员写代码的工具。
2. 下载并安装VS2022
通常C# 开发者 使用 Visual Studio 2022 进行开发工作
- 下载:Visual Studio 2022 下载
- 安装:安装的时候注意选择好对应的工作负荷即可,其他基本都是下一步下一步即可。
三、学习资料
通过这里收集的资料,我们可以帮助快速高效的学习C#
- 官方 - C#文档
- 官方 - .NET 文档
- DotNetGuide - GitHub开源项目 、DotNetGuide - 加速地址
- 全面的C#/.NET自学入门指南
- 官方技术文档
结语
回到目录页: C# 知识汇总
希望以上内容可以帮助到大家,如文中有不对之处,还请批评指正。